Applications of Small Storage Containers
Small storage containers are a go-to solution for decluttering and arranging. Here are some common locations and innovative ways they can be used:
1. Home Organization
Cooking area: Use stackable or transparent containers for spices, grains, tea bags, or treats. Labeling guarantees you never grab the wrong active ingredient.
Bathroom: Store toiletries, cotton bud, skin care items, or soap bars in water resistant containers to preserve cleanliness.
Bed room: Organize drawers with small dividers to arrange socks, fashion jewelry, and accessories. You can likewise use ornamental storage boxes to organize keepsakes and bedtime essentials.
2. Workplace Use
Keep your work desk clutter-free by storing pens, paper clips, chargers, sticky notes, and other workplace supplies in compartmentalized containers.
Archive old receipts, essential documents, or company cards in little, labeled boxes for simple access when needed.
3. Kids' Playroom
Sorting toys by size or type in small containers not just makes cleaning up much easier however likewise teaches kids organizational routines.
Shop art supplies such as crayons, brushes, and beads in clear containers to simplify access during innovative activities.
4. Traveling
Little storage containers are ideal for compact packaging. Store precious jewelry, toiletries, mini cosmetics, cables, or treats in separate, light-weight containers for easy company on the go.
5. Garage and Workshop
Tools like screws, nails, and bolts can be nicely organized in labeled containers for fuss-free DIY projects.
Declutter your workspace by classifying items like batteries, tapes, or paints into small compartments.
What to Look For in Small Storage Containers
When buying small storage containers, key features determine their utility, sturdiness, and usefulness. Consider the following:
Material:

Plastic: Lightweight, durable, and budget-friendly. Perfect for kitchens, kids' spaces, and outdoor use.
Glass: Sleek and transparent but much heavier. Recommended for aesthetic appeals or food storage.
Fabric: Suitable for saving clothes or softer products but not moisture-resistant.
Metal: Durable and rugged, best for durable storage in garages or workshops.
Shapes and size:
Ensure the size fits your area and desired function. Stackable containers conserve area in small locations.
Style:
Transparent containers supply presence of contents.
Containers with covers or zippers avoid dust or water damage.
Reduce of Maintenance:

Try to find products that are simple to tidy and preserve for long-term functionality.
Eco-Friendliness:
Multiple-use or naturally degradable alternatives contribute to sustainability.
